Master the Art of Ingress Control: Unveiling the Power of Class Names in SEO

Master the Art of Ingress Control: Unveiling the Power of Class Names in SEO
ingress control class name

Open-Source AI Gateway & Developer Portal

In the ever-evolving digital landscape, SEO (Search Engine Optimization) has become a critical aspect for businesses seeking to gain visibility online. One of the key components in the SEO puzzle is the use of class names within your website's HTML structure. This article delves into the art of ingress control and the significance of class names in optimizing your website's search engine rankings.

Understanding Class Names

Before we dive into the details, it's important to have a clear understanding of what class names are. Class names are attributes assigned to HTML elements in the form of class="name". They are used to group elements and apply CSS styles en masse, making them an essential tool in the development of modern, responsive websites.

The Role of Class Names in SEO

1. Improved Site Structure

Class names can greatly improve the structure of your website. By using descriptive class names, you make your site more organized and easier for search engines to crawl. This can lead to better indexing and, subsequently, higher rankings.

2. Semantics and Readability

Semantically meaningful class names make your HTML code more readable and maintainable. Search engines favor sites that are easy to understand and navigate, which is why good class names are a vital component of SEO.

3. Accessibility

Descriptive class names also improve accessibility by providing clear information about the role of an element to screen readers and other assistive technologies. This can enhance the user experience for individuals with disabilities and positively impact your SEO.

4. Content Reuse and Flexibility

Class names enable you to reuse content and apply styles across multiple elements. This flexibility not only speeds up the development process but also helps to ensure consistent branding and user experience, which are important factors for SEO.

Crafting Effective Class Names

1. Use Descriptive and Consistent Naming Conventions

Choose class names that describe what the element is or does. For instance, use product-description instead of desc or pd. Consistency in naming conventions is crucial, whether you choose to use kebab-case, PascalCase, or camelCase.

2. Avoid Special Characters and Numbers

Avoid using special characters or numbers in class names unless absolutely necessary. This is because special characters can cause issues with CSS selectors and can sometimes be overlooked by search engines.

3. Prioritize Readability Over Length

While it's important to be descriptive, keep your class names as short as possible while maintaining readability. This helps to keep your HTML and CSS more manageable and can potentially improve page load times.

APIPark is a high-performance AI gateway that allows you to securely access the most comprehensive LLM APIs globally on the APIPark platform, including OpenAI, Anthropic, Mistral, Llama2, Google Gemini, and more.Try APIPark now! πŸ‘‡πŸ‘‡πŸ‘‡

Real-World Examples

Below is a table that illustrates the use of class names in different scenarios:

Scenario Bad Class Name Good Class Name
Button btn button-submit
Paragraph p main-paragraph
Navigation nav top-navigation
Footer footer page-footer
Image img feature-image

API Gateway and Class Names

The integration of API gateways into modern web development is crucial for managing the communication between applications. One such powerful tool is APIPark, an open-source AI gateway and API management platform. When using APIPark, class names play a role in structuring the front-end to interact seamlessly with the backend.

APIPark and Class Names

APIPark allows developers to manage API gateways with ease, ensuring that class names used on the front end correspond accurately to the APIs being called. This synchronization is crucial for effective ingress control, where class names can be used to filter and direct API requests.

SEO and Open Platforms

As the digital world becomes increasingly interconnected, the importance of open platforms in SEO cannot be overstated. Open platforms, like APIPark, offer a collaborative space for developers to innovate and share their work. This collective effort can lead to a richer, more accessible web, which is favored by search engines.

Conclusion

The power of class names in SEO is undeniable. By using descriptive, consistent, and readable class names, you can improve the structure, readability, and accessibility of your website. This, in turn, can lead to better search engine rankings and a more positive user experience. As you continue to optimize your website for search engines, remember that every small detail, such as class names, contributes to the larger SEO puzzle.

FAQ

  1. What is the difference between class names and IDs in HTML? Class names are used for grouping elements with common styles, while IDs are unique identifiers for individual elements. Both can be used with CSS for styling but IDs are generally more specific and can affect only one element.
  2. Why are class names important for SEO? Class names help in structuring the website better, which makes it easier for search engines to crawl and index the site. They also improve the readability of HTML code and can be used for accessibility enhancements.
  3. How do class names contribute to website performance? Well-chosen class names can reduce the size of CSS files and make the code easier to maintain, potentially leading to faster loading times. This can have a positive impact on user experience and SEO.
  4. Can class names affect user experience on a website? Absolutely. Using clear, descriptive class names can make it easier for developers to create a consistent and intuitive user interface, which can improve user satisfaction and engagement.
  5. Is there a best practice for choosing class names in CSS? The best practice is to use class names that are descriptive and consistent. Stick to naming conventions like kebab-case, PascalCase, or camelCase, and avoid special characters and numbers unless necessary.

πŸš€You can securely and efficiently call the OpenAI API on APIPark in just two steps:

Step 1: Deploy the APIPark AI gateway in 5 minutes.

APIPark is developed based on Golang, offering strong product performance and low development and maintenance costs. You can deploy APIPark with a single command line.

curl -sSO https://download.apipark.com/install/quick-start.sh; bash quick-start.sh
APIPark Command Installation Process

In my experience, you can see the successful deployment interface within 5 to 10 minutes. Then, you can log in to APIPark using your account.

APIPark System Interface 01

Step 2: Call the OpenAI API.

APIPark System Interface 02